Output 326abe2000d875f8effcfe934db5694c831520e5d128bedbba8a02e803256617:1

value
3354298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 007cacc6ae5e29915d07319fed37148fe0b1edbf OP_EQUAL
address
9rUr1xHuWYyUf1RmWWoG1fLDftPAEmzhuB
transaction
326abe2000d875f8effcfe934db5694c831520e5d128bedbba8a02e803256617